Java 字符串替換
字符串替換
String類中提供了幾種可以替換指定字符串中特定內(nèi)容的方法,替換方法也同時(shí)支持正則表達(dá) 式的入?yún)ⅲㄕ齽t表達(dá)式是一種表示一類字符串的描述,之后將對(duì)正則表達(dá)式進(jìn)行詳細(xì)介紹)。 String類中提供了兩個(gè)同名replace()方法,一個(gè)入?yún)閮蓚€(gè)單一字符:
replace(char oldChar, char newChar)
另一個(gè)人參為兩個(gè)CharSequence接口類:
replace(CharSequence target, CharSequence replacement)
CharBuffer、Segment、String、StringBuffer、StringBuiWer都實(shí)現(xiàn)CharSequence接口,也就是說(shuō) 上面的類都可以作為rephice()方法的入?yún)ⅰeplace()方法是對(duì)大小寫(xiě)敏感的,也就是說(shuō)“Abc”和“abc”并不相同。如果大小寫(xiě)書(shū)寫(xiě)不一 致,代碼就不能正確地替換所要替換的內(nèi)容。同時(shí),replace()方法也不支持正則表達(dá)式。
點(diǎn)擊加載更多評(píng)論>>